(Springfield Gardens, NY) - Oscar Hopkins recently celebrated his 50th year working as a licensed barber in the Queens and Brooklyn communities.

Hop, as he is called by his dedicated customers opened his first barbershop in 1966.
Since the early 1970s the successful entrepreneur has been Owner/Operator of
The Hopkins Barbershop on Merrick Blvd., in Springfield Gardens, Queens.

The barbershop has served an estimated half-a-million customers.

Hopkins is credited with giving scores of young men a future by teaching them the barber trade.

A native of Sumter, South Carolina and Korean War Veteran, Hopkins attributes his success to faith, family, hard work and having a plan.

Hopkins said it wasn’t always easy. He credits his late wife and childhood sweetheart, Novell, for her support and encouragement during challenging times.
